How long should a design proposal be?

Your document should not be too long, causing your client to skim or skip sections. Yes, your proposal should be just the right length. So, how long should your proposal be? Proposify discovered that the most common winning proposal length is ten pages According to their audit of 1.6 million proposals.

What is a design project proposal?

What is a design proposal? A design proposal is a document or a series of slides that set out your plan for a design project. Normally requested by clients, it’s a way for them to compare the value that different designers are offering them.

How long should a research proposal take?

How long does it need to be? Most research proposals are between 1500 and 2000 words long. What’s a research proposal for? Your proposal gives a relatively brief overview of what you would like to study.

How do you present a new project proposal?

Steps to writing your own project proposal

  1. Step 1: Define the problem.
  2. Step 2: Present your solution.
  3. Step 3: Define your deliverables and success criteria.
  4. Step 4: State your plan or approach.
  5. Step 5: Outline your project schedule and budget.
  6. Step 6: Tie it all together.
  7. Step 7: Edit/proofread your proposal.

What does a design proposal look like?

You proposal should include sections like the background or “Why me?”, pricing, timeline, deliverables and terms & conditions. Make sure you explain what they get in option two, that they don’t get in option one and so on.

When to use an unsolicited proposal template?

Many companies will use an RFP template to give potential suppliers details of what they are looking for in a bid. It will usually give a timeline of when items are due and what they are looking for in the document. The unsolicited proposal is initiated by the person who writes it.
